One such robot that has gained significant popularity is the MiR (Mobile Industrial Robot).

The MiR is an autonomous mobile robot designed to navigate through dynamic environments, carrying out various tasks. Its versatility and adaptability make it an ideal choice for a wide range of industries, including manufacturing, logistics, and healthcare. Whether it’s transporting goods, delivering materials, or performing quality inspections, the MiR can seamlessly integrate into your existing operations, enhancing productivity and efficiency.

It effortlessly navigates through obstacles, avoiding collisions and ensuring the safety of both humans and goods.

The MiR is equipped with advanced sensors and cutting-edge technology that enable it to map its surroundings and plan the most efficient routes. This ensures optimal utilization of resources and minimizes unnecessary movements. With its robust payload capacity, the MiR can transport heavy loads, saving time and reducing the risk of injuries associated with manual handling.
